    U.S. Marine Corps Lance Cpl. Kaden Terrell, left, an ammunition specialists and Lance Cpl. Azariah Nied, an assistant gunner, both with Golf Company, 2nd Battalion, 5th Marine Regiment, 1st Marine Division, fire a M240B during a live-fire platoon attack as a part of Service Level Training Exercise 4-26 at Range 410A, Marine Corps Air Ground Combat Center, Twentynine Palms, California, July 20, 2026. SLTE is a premier training event that ensures the Marine Corps remains a highly lethal, adaptable force capable of dominating the future multi-domain fight. (U.S. Marine Corps photo by Sgt Daniel Avilaramirez)
